Understanding Door Hinges
Before diving into the advantages of same-day door hinge repair, it's necessary to understand the types of door hinges and the common issues connected with them.
Typical Types of Door Hinges
Hinge Type
Description
Typical Use
Butt Hinge
Two plates joined by a pin, usually installed on the edge of a door
Interior doors
Constant Hinge
A long hinge that runs the entire length of the door
Heavy commercial doors
Hidden Hinge
Concealed when the door is closed, offering a tidy visual
Modern cabinets and high-end surfaces
Pivot Hinge
Enables the door to pivot rather of swinging on a hinge
Heavy or large doors
Common Issues Faced with Door Hinges
- Squeaking Noises: Caused by lack of lubrication or wear and tear.
- Misalignment: The door might not close properly, typically due to use in time.
- Rust and Corrosion: Particularly in outdoor settings or damp environments.
- Broken or Worn-Out Hinges: Eventually, hinges can break or lose their function completely.
Understanding these problems can assist house owners take better care of their doors and acknowledge when they require professional intervention.

What to Expect During a Repair Service
When you require a same-day door hinge repair, you can anticipate a professional process that looks something like this:
Repair Process Steps
- Preliminary Assessment: A technician will examine the door and hinges to determine the extent of the issue.
- Suggestion: Based on their evaluation, they will recommend a course of action, consisting of possible repair or replacement.
- Execution of the Repair: This might involve tightening screws, using lubricant, or changing the hinge entirely.
- Test the Fix: Once the repair is made, the technician will evaluate the door to guarantee it works effectively.
- Final Inspection: A thorough check will be carried out to guarantee everything is secure and in working order.
Cost Considerations
The cost of same-day door hinge repair can differ based on a number of factors:
Cost Factor
Description
Approximated Cost Range
Type of Hinge
Butt, continuous, concealed, pivot
₤ 10 - ₤ 50 per hinge
Labor Fees
Cost of service per hour
₤ 50 - ₤ 100 per hour
Parts Replacement
If new parts are needed
Varies, generally ₤ 15 - ₤ 100
Extra Repairs
Other concerns recognized throughout repair
Varies
Always request a comprehensive estimate before work begins to prevent unforeseen costs.
